What's Happening?
A crane machine caught fire near the Metra tracks in Chicago's Ashburn neighborhood. Despite the proximity to the Metra Southwest line, train services were not affected, and no injuries were reported. The incident was managed without significant disruption
to the local community or transportation services. The cause of the fire has not been detailed, but the quick response ensured minimal impact.
